Ingredients for Garlic Lemon Butter For Grilled Salmon

  • 4 tablespoons (1/2 stick) un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Lemon, Juice Of
  • Salt And Pepper

How to Make Garlic Lemon Butter For Grilled Salmon

  1. In a small bowl, combine melted butter, minced garlic, lemon juice, lemon zest, salt, and pepper.
  2. Place salmon fillets on a preheated grill.
  3. Grill salmon for 3-4 minutes per side, or until cooked through.
  4. During the last 2 minutes of grilling, generously baste the salmon with the garlic lemon butter mixture.
  5. Remove salmon from grill and serve immediately. Garnish with extra lemon wedges and fresh herbs, if desired.
